CUDA by Example: An Introduction to General-Purpose GPU Programming

PDF
- eBook:CUDA by Example: An Introduction to General-Purpose GPU Programming
- Author:Jason Sanders, Edward Kandrot
- Edition:1 edition
- Categories:
- Data:July 19, 2010
- ISBN:0131387685
- ISBN-13:9780131387683
- Language:English
- Pages:320 pages
- Format:PDF
CUDA by Example, written by two senior members of the CUDA software platform team, shows programmers how to employ this new technology. The authors introduce each area of CUDA development through working examples. After a concise introduction to the CUDA platform and architecture, as well as a quick-start guide to CUDA C, the book details the techniques and trade-offs associated with each key CUDA feature. You’ll discover when to use each CUDA C extension and how to write CUDA software that delivers truly outstanding performance.
Major topics covered include
- Parallel programming
- Thread cooperation
- Constant memory and events
- Texture memory
- Graphics interoperability
- Atomics
- Streams
- CUDA C on multiple GPUs
- Advanced atomics
- Additional CUDA resources
Content
Chapter 2. Getting Started
Chapter 3. Introduction to CUDA C
Chapter 4. Parallel Programming in CUDA C
Chapter 5. Thread Cooperation
Chapter 6. Constant Memory and Events
Chapter 7. Texture Memory
Chapter 8. Graphics Interoperability
Chapter 9. Atomics
Chapter 10. Streams
Chapter 11. CUDA C on Multiple GPUs
Chapter 12. The Final Countdown
Download CUDA by Example: An Introduction to General-Purpose GPU Programming PDF or ePUB format free
Free sample